B&B WEEK OF DECEMBER 17, 2007 RECAPS

Week of Monday, December 17, 2007

JPI

Wednesday, December 19, 2007

Felicia was alarmed when her mother announced that she won't host Christmas. "I just don't have it in me to do it this year," Stephanie lamented. "I want to be alone." Felicia tried to change her mind, but to no avail. Stephanie then visited Stephen in jail and urged him to confess. "You're crazy," Stephen declared. Steph said she would ask the D.A. to make a plea bargain if Stephen would just admit he shot her. He refused and professed his trust in Storm proving his innocence. Stephanie then threatened to put Stephen in the "worst penitentiary in the state."

"Tell me the truth," Brooke asked Storm. At first, he tried stonewalling, then revealed how Stephen blamed Storm for allowing Brooke's rape to happen. He started to seethe about how Stephen swooped in and suddenly appointed himself family protector, a mantle Storm had nobly assumed for years. "He was taking you away from me and I couldn't let that happen," Storm babbled, then admitted, "I did it." He crumpled to the sofa and explained how he couldn't tolerate the pain Stephanie had caused his sisters plus Stephen's interference. He recounted how he was the one who turned on Jake's video camera, then, knowing Stephanie was supposed to meet Eric in the showroom, put on his class ring (similar to Stephen's) and shot her. He banked on Jake eventually finding the video footage. Both Brooke and Katie were devastated by the confession. "Please tell me you're making this up," Katie begged, but Storm couldn't. When Brooke pointed out that their father is in jail for a crime he didn't commit, Storm said Stephen deserves to stay there. Storm then urged them to stay mum. "I earned your loyalty ... now it's time for you to return the favor," Storm declared.
